The suburbs, states and territories driving a solar boom

An enormous shift is underway on the rooftops of Australian households, with new knowledge revealing that households dispatched extra solar energy to the grid final summer season than the brown coal trade.

Figures printed by the Clear Power Council on Tuesday present rooftop photo voltaic supplied a document 14 per cent of Australia’s energy, or 8046 Gigawatt hours (GWh) – a 19.5 per cent rise.

“There isn’t a doubt with inflation and price of dwelling pressures, individuals are turning to rooftop photo voltaic in document numbers,” Clear Power Council chief govt Kane Thornton stated on Tuesday.

“We’re seeing a basic shift; shoppers have gotten vitality turbines, making their very own clear vitality, lowering their payments and taking over the electrical energy firms.”

Mr Thornton stated that the CEC’s evaluation additionally solely contains energy despatched again to the grid, which means households had been producing way more photo voltaic electrical energy that they used themselves.

Greater than three million households throughout Australia now personal photo voltaic panels, with the time it takes for a 7 kilowatt (kw) system to pay for itself in decrease energy payments falling to a document low 3.four years.

Stephanie Grey, deputy director at advocacy group Photo voltaic Residents, stated that whereas the variety of photo voltaic installations fell from a document excessive in 2021, Australians had been putting in far bigger methods.

“Rooftop photo voltaic stays a terrific funding and it is actually one of the best ways to guard your self from globally excessive coal and fuel costs which might be more likely to stay excessive for years to return,” she stated.

“One of the simplest ways to get bang for buck out of your system is to shift your electrical energy use to the daytime the place doable, so that you’re using a budget photo voltaic vitality straight out of your rooftop.”

Solar energy: State-by-state

The CEC’s figures present South Australia continues to prepared the ground on rooftop photo voltaic as a proportion of its electrical energy base, with 27.6 per cent of its energy generated by households.

The suburbs of Salisbury, Morphett Vale, Aberfoyle Park, Smithfield Plains and O’Halloran Hill had been the most important photo voltaic vitality producing components of South Australia, the CEC figures reveal.

New South Wales, in the meantime, has been the most important improver over the previous 12 months, with 13.1 per cent of the historically fossil gas reliant state’s electrical energy now being fed into the grid from roofs.

Lismore, Beaumont Hills, Ballimore, Alison and Airds had been the highest 5 performing suburbs for rooftop photo voltaic manufacturing in NSW – serving to the state obtain 2216 GwHs of photo voltaic era.

Queensland was the second largest producer of rooftop solar energy in absolute phrases, with 2039 GwHs produced, led by Abbortsford, Booral, Aroona, Athol and Augustine Heights.

Fossil fuels nonetheless dominate electrical energy in Queensland, nevertheless, with rooftop photo voltaic solely accounting for 12.5 per cent of the state’s complete energy era – a 14.7 per cent improve on final 12 months.

Victoria, regardless of being Australia’s second hottest state, was ranked third in rooftop photo voltaic manufacturing, recording 1590 GWhs, which was 12.2 per cent of the state’s complete grid wants.

However Victoria has seen the function of its rooftop photo voltaic ecosystem develop, up 12.2 per cent as a proportion of complete electrical energy era throughout the state over the previous 12 months.

The highest suburbs in Victoria had been Hoppers Crossing, Cranbourne North, Craigieburn, Werribee South and Narre Warren South.

West Australia was ranked second among the many states for the function photo voltaic performs in its general grid, with 21.four % of its energy being generated on rooftops final summer season, in accordance with the CEC.

That was up 15.7 per cent on final 12 months, with Mandurah, Wangara, Forrestdale, Cockburn Central and Canning Vale South main the best way throughout Australia’s greatest geography.
